Hi miller75,
BT Premium WHW supports AX3700 which is 2.4GHz 400Mbps 11n, 5GHz 866Mbps 11ac and 5GHz (Backbone) 2400Mbps 11ax so the speeds you are experiencing are as expected for this product.
I would guess this test was carried out connected to the primary disc. I would not imagine you would see this speed connected to a secondary disc traversing the backhaul.
